New to Football Goal Rush or just want to confirm what a market term actually means before you stake? These plain-language definitions cover the key words you will see inside the room — from how in-play odds work to what settlement timing means for your wallet.

01
What does 'total goals' mean in Football Goal Rush?

Total goals is a market where you predict whether the combined number of goals scored in a match will be over or under a set line — for example, over 2.5 means three or more goals must be scored for that position to win. Own goals usually count toward the total.

02
What is a 'first goal scorer' market?

A first goal scorer market asks you to pick which team scores the opening goal of the match, not which individual player. The position settles the moment the first confirmed goal hits the scoreboard, regardless of what happens in the rest of the match.

03
What does 'both teams to score' mean?

Both teams to score (BTTS) is a yes or no market — yes wins if both sides put at least one goal in the net before the final whistle, no wins if either team ends the match without scoring. A 0–0 result always settles the no option.

04
What is an 'in-play' or live market?

An in-play market is one you can open after the match has already started. Football Goal Rush updates in-play lines continuously as the match progresses, so the odds you see on a total-goals market in the 60th minute already account for the current scoreline and match tempo.

05
What does 'market suspension' mean?

Market suspension is a short window when the Football Goal Rush bet form is locked while the odds provider recalibrates lines after a major match event — a goal, red card, or penalty decision. The suspension is brief and the market reopens with updated odds once the feed confirms the event.

06
What is 'settlement' in Football Goal Rush?

Settlement is the process of confirming the match result and posting the outcome to your account. Once the full-time whistle sounds and the data provider confirms the final scoreline, your Football Goal Rush positions are checked against the result and any returns are added to your wallet balance automatically.

07
What does 'clean sheet' mean as a market?

A clean sheet market pays out if the team you selected does not concede a single goal during the match. It is a separate market from total goals — a match can end 2–0 with the winning team keeping a clean sheet while the total goals line still goes over.

08
What is 'last goal scorer' in Football Goal Rush?

Last goal scorer asks which team scores the final goal before the full-time whistle. It settles only after the match ends, unlike first goal scorer which settles early. The result is confirmed against the official match data once the data provider closes the fixture.

09
What does 'odds movement' mean in a live goal market?

Odds movement refers to the change in a market's price as match conditions shift — a goal being scored, a red card, or a team winning several corners in quick succession can all cause odds to shorten or lengthen.
